DEA Mandate: Updated Protocols for Controlled Substance Prescriptions

4/24/2025

0 Comments

 
Picture
Attention Kem Road Animal Hospital ClientsEffective April 2025, Kem Road Animal Hospital has implemented revised protocols for controlled substance prescriptions in compliance with DEA regulations. These changes impact how certain medications for your pets are prescribed and refilled.
Controlled Medications Affected by This UpdateThe following medications prescribed at Kem Road Animal Hospital fall under these protocols:
  • Tramadol
  • Phenobarbital
  • Alprazolam
  • Buprenorphine oral solution
  • Tussigon (Hydrocodone)
  • Gabapentin*
*While Gabapentin is not currently classified as a controlled substance by the DEA, our clinic will apply the same refill protocols to this medication.
Refill Protocol RequirementsUnder the updated DEA guidelines:
  • All controlled prescriptions are limited to 30-60 day quantities
  • Refill requests must be submitted at least 72 hours before pickup
  • Medications cannot be refilled earlier than 5 days before depletion
  • If your pet runs out of medication and is due for an examination, we can provide up to 5 days' worth of medication to bridge until the appointment
Mandatory Examination ScheduleTo maintain compliance with federal regulations:
  1. Pets on controlled substances must be examined by a Kem Road veterinarian every 6 months
  2. Laboratory work is required every 3-6 months, with frequency determined by medication type and individual patient factors
Regulatory ContextThe United States Department of Justice/Drug Enforcement Administration (DEA) classifies controlled substances as chemicals and pharmaceutical agents with potential for abuse. These regulations are designed to ensure appropriate use while preventing misuse.
